Unstoppable sound (almost)

My browser / operating system: Windows NT 10.0, Chrome 131.0.0.0, No Flash version detected

How to recreate:
Make a clone play the sound, and delete the clone.

Expected result:
The sound stops when the stop sign is clicked or a stop all sounds block runs
Maybe it stops when the clone is deleted

Actual result:
The sound can be stopped only if you restart the sound.

Example scripts: (put them in an empty project)
when I start as a clone
start sound (long sound v) // eg. Classical Piano
delete this clone
click these
create clone of (myself v)
stop all sounds // doesn't work
click @greenFlag or @stopSign::grey // doesn't work
start sound (long sound v) // this way it works because it first restarts the sound
stop all sounds
